Motor Image Pilipinas Inc. (MIPI), the exclusive distributor of Subaru vehicles in the Philippines made a special visit to share joy with the residents of Hospicio De San José, located in the city of Manila.
Glenn Tan, Deputy Chairman and Managing Director of Tan Chong International Limited, the principal of MIPI, was on hand to personally turn over Subaru merchandise as well as a check from funds raised at the recent 2023 Manila International Auto Show 2023. The ticket sales from the Subaru x Russ Swift Rustle and Hustle stunt shows that ran for the duration of the MIAS raised a total of Php 139,000, and 100% of this was gifted to the institution.
“We would like to thank Mr. Glenn Tan and Subaru Philippines for their generosity and continuous support to Hospicio de San Jose. The gifts and monetary proceeds will be of great help for us here as this would allow us to continue our commitment of providing integral development to vulnerable and excluded sectors of society,” said Sr. Martha Gamolo, DC.
“We are delighted to support the beneficiaries of Hospicio De San Jose, as their mission aligns with Tan Chong International Limited’s values of being reliable and responsible in all our business practices as we aim to provide care, support, a sense of belonging and empowerment to both our employees and customers while fostering hope for a brighter future. I hope this initiative reinforces and reminds the beneficiaries that they are not just recipients of gift-giving but part of something bigger – our Tan Chong community,” said Tan
